Influential as a Noun has these synonyms:
powerful, weighty, strong, forceful, effective, effectual, efficacious, instrumental, telling, significant, persuasive, dominant, leading, guiding, authoritative, predominant, important, substantial, prestigious, controllingExample: He comes from an influential family. What factors were influential in reaching your decision.
